Full Circle


There is muted beauty in areas struck by forest fires. 

I would photograph topless, leafless trees with blackened branches and broken stems as much as I would  grand leafy trees that beckon: "sit by me."

In their jarring appearance, the fire victims speak of our amazing eco-system and how out of devastation, birds, bees, the wind, rain -- all miraculously make new growth possible.

Patiently awaiting deliverance from its charred and maimed state,  trees still reach for the sky and life continues its wonderful circle of death and renewal.
